Photo: CORE/YouTube The “totally awesome” Fast Times at Ridgemont High table read was every bit as chaotic as its cast list. Sean Penn scraped together some of Hollywood’s biggest stars for a virtual table read of the Amy Heckerling cult classic, written by Cameron Crowe. Joining the original star were stand-ins Shia LaBeouf, Jimmy Kimmel, Henry Golding, John Legend, Ray Liotta, Matthew McConaughey, Julia Roberts, Brad Pitt, Jennifer Aniston, host Dane Cook, and narrator Morgan Freeman.
Most of the table read’s chaotic energy came from Shia LaBeouf getting really into his role as head stoner Jeff Spicoli. From the very beginning, he lights up what appears to be a real joint in his car in his garage. Then, he took on Spicoli’s low and confused voice to play the role Sean Penn originated, mimed driving with his real steering wheel, and gave it his opening-night best, all while taking off his shirt, switching sunglasses, and running in and out of the car. No table, no rules.
